Transaction 4caaf3a66833dc6f2859341e70420611554e588cdd90fb40375c2b95d7251a37
1 Input
1 Output
-
4caaf3a66833dc6f2859341e70420611554e588cdd90fb40375c2b95d7251a37:0
- value
- 2552708
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 627e5c1677e2b16939b2cec82d9c917016e86229 OP_EQUAL
- address
- 3AfoWyEAc8vF23JETt8dMqJXWoZ2rcCJxK